Overview

Murray Cod Australia Limited (ASX:MCA) has appointed Kelly Sperl as Chief Financial Officer and Company Secretary, effective 22 June 2026. She brings more than 25 years of finance leadership experience across ASX-listed, private, and family-owned businesses, including roles in FMCG, manufacturing, and distribution sectors. The Board expects her expertise in financial management, business transformation, and operational performance to support MCA’s strategic objectives. A structured transition will take place with outgoing CFO Wendy Dillon, who will step down by 30 September 2026.

What Experience Does the New CFO Bring to MCA?

Kelly Sperl is a Chartered Accountant with extensive leadership experience across major FMCG and manufacturing businesses, including Foster’s Group, STIHL Australia, Bakers Delight, Gale Pacific, and PaperlinX. Her background includes financial management, treasury, ERP implementation, and business transformation across multiple industries. The Board believes her operational and commercial expertise will strengthen MCA’s financial capabilities and support improved performance as the company focuses on scaling as a premium food business.

How Will the CFO Transition Be Managed at MCA?

MCA has announced a structured transition process to ensure continuity in financial leadership. Incoming CFO Kelly Sperl will work closely with outgoing CFO Wendy Dillon during the handover period. Ms Dillon will remain with the company until 30 September 2026, unless an earlier mutual agreement is reached. The Board has thanked Ms Dillon for her contributions and expressed confidence that the transition will support operational stability and ongoing strategic execution.
